He lives in Cuba, but his music isn’t entirely Cuban. He was born in Chile, but it’s not strictly Chilean. He records in France but it’s not… Well, what it is, is interesting & unpredictable. He’s got a fluid voice, a good band, & his songs are hard to pin down as he blends everything from Andean pipes to programming. Good stuff.
